Taco Bell IT Manager Salaries in Riverside, CA

The average Taco Bell IT Manager in Riverside, CA earns an estimated $137,944 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$125,122 with a $12,822 bonus. Taco Bell's IT Manager compensation is $24,855 more than the US average for a IT Manager. IT Manager salaries at Taco Bell in Riverside, CA can range from $88,000 - $190,000.

In Riverside, CA, The IT Department at Taco Bell earns $2,922 more on average than the Admin Department.

IT Manager Compensation by Gender (All Companies)

The average female IT Manager at companies similar size to Taco Bell reported making $132,858, while the average male IT Manager at similar sized companies reported making $134,612.

IT Manager Compensation by Ethnicity (All Companies)

The average Asian or Pacific Islander IT Manager at companies similar size to Taco Bell reported making $135,089, while the average Native American IT Manager at similar sized companies reported making $118,703.
